

A good experience backend developer. Candidate should possess all the necessary skills. The company will support him to mentor further

Similar jobs
1. Design patterns- socket communication/ micro services architecture
2. Caching - REDIS MEMCACHED etc
3. Database - MONGO, SQL etc. min 2yrs experience with these.
4. Features created for large concurrent requests.
5. Node Js, Go lang any asynchronous programming language min 2 yrs exp with any one of them.
6. Message Queues - RABBIT MQ, Kafka etc.
7. Logging and APM (application process manager) good to have.
8. DS ALGO good to have.
Job Responsibility and Duties
-We are looking for talent who is quick learner and grasp things quickly, well understand the requirement of feature/product, analysis the risk or edge cases, find the possible solutions and able to implement the one solutions out of proposed.
-Open for taking ownership of the feature and quality as leader. Able to design the user experience.
-You are responsible for the release quality feature on time.
-Your day to day job may involve system design, writing quality code, unit testing, team/co-worker handling, collaborative working and solution driven outcome execution.
Qualification & Skills
-Actually degree doesn’t matter but if you did B.Tech./B.E/M.Tech/M.E./MCA good for the positions.
-This position for the node.js backend engineer.
-This other skill into your profile adds you more benefits, knowing multiple language such as python, golang, fullstack developer(also knows react.js, vue.js)
According to your talent we have 5 classification on Backend Engineering Department
- Software Engineer 3-5LPA
- Sr Software Engineer 5-8LPA
- Lead Software Engineer 8-15LPA
- Tech Lead 15-25LPA
- Architects & System Designer 25-50LPA
About Freespace* (a.k.a. Workplace Fabric)
Workplace Fabric develops solutions that makes workplaces intelligent. Our solutions help increase productivity of office workers while helping to lower the cost of real estate. Our Flagship
product Freespace is installed in over 40 cities around the world and serves over 30,000 people every day. Starting with the first deployment in March 2016 we have rapidly grown with our solution being rolled out globally while continuing to stay cash positive. With successes at several blue-chip clients Workplace Fabric has carved a unique leadership position in workplace management and employee engagement SaaS solutions.
*To find out more, follow us on social media – LinkedIn & Facebook @ workplace-fabric
What is on our offer?
- An absolutely action packed, fun, and demanding workplace lets our employees to thrive in a team-based environment with passion, fun, pride and teamwork as our core values.
- We can offer you career opportunities to challenge, develop and exceed your aspirations with training and development throughout your career.
- Life is never dull at Freespace as there is always something to learn, constantly pushing you to develop your skills and take on the next exciting challenge.
Profile Brief:
You will be an experienced Backend Engineer with an interest in data and analytics, developing our fast growing Analytics Team. Working closely as an active team member, having ownership & accountability to develop analytics stories, in delivering timely projects through Scrum. Working with product owners and team leads to clarifying requirements, challenge assumptions in order to ensure successful executions and push the client analytics to its best.
Key Skills and Experience
Required Skills: JavaScript (ES6+), SQL, Nodejs, AWS (Lambda, Athena, S3)
Good to have: TypeScript, IoT, AWS Certifications
Experience: 4-6 years
- Data processing and manipulation expert
- Able to easily comprehend and write complex & efficient SQL queries
- Ability to understand, design and fully document end-to-end scalable IoT systems
- Expert in in building Well-Architected solutions using AWS Services (eg Lambda, Athena, S3 etc)
- Master in JavaScript with excellent understanding of asynchronous patterns
- Comfortable with of ES6+, TypeScript & emerging web technologies
- Experience of building secure, metered REST APIs and connectors for BI tools like Tableau and PowerBI
- Hands-on programmer
Page Break
Key Behaviours
- Be passionate about understanding the business problem and using data to tell the stories in delivering solutions which drive client decisions.
- Lead by example by demonstrating best practice and mentoring of team members
- Clear thinker with a systematic problem-solving approach, breaking the problem down into simple achievable and realistically estimated steps
- Seeing a project through from conception into production and support ensuring quality throughout.
- Ensure high standards by instilling data quality checks, code reviews and documentation in work and team practices.
- Able to challenge solutions and processes in creating the best products and environment to work.
- Unafraid to own mistakes
- Customer focussed
About SATISFIC
Satisfic is focused on the areas of the IT channel marketing. As the channel catalyst, we connect and empower technology suppliers, solution providers and end-users. Headquartered in Singapore and with teams across key countries in APAC, Satisfic leverages its regional service delivery capabilities to help IT channel succeed and grow.
Please visit our site at http://www.satisfic.com">www.satisfic.com for further details.
What you will be doing:
- SATISFIC is a product-based company; hence will be required to work on product development and support.
- Need to work on the following technologies – Angular, Node JS, Core Web API and PostgreSQL.
- SATISFIC’s product is hosted in AWS. This will provide you with an opportunity to work on the latest cloud technologies
- Coding computer programs.
- Integrate user-facing elements developed by front-end developers with server-side logic.
- Writing reusable, testable, and efficient code and libraries for future use.
- Implementation of security and data protection.
- Timely completion of daily assigned projects as per requirements
- Complete adherence to all metrics and parameters associated with each project through completion of project.
- Effective Time management.
- Mentor and assist Trainee/ Junior Software Engineers to complete assigned tasks.
- Check coding standards and deliverables against each project/product specifications for their own and their junior engineers before delivery.
- Develop module specification documents for internal purpose.
- Lead continuous improvement activities by driving the implementation of process and product quality improvement initiatives.
- Develop innovative solutions that improve the efficiency and reliability of the deliverables and system.
About your experience:
- Total work experience of more than 5 years and minimum 3+ years in development
- Has led a team of developers and coders on Node js
- 3-4 years of proven experience in Node.Js and frameworks available for it.
- Strong proficiency with JavaScript/TypeScript.
- Troubleshoot and debug applications.
- Expertise with Services (REST, SOAP, JSON) and APIs (Service-oriented architectures).
- User authentication and authorization between multiple systems, servers, and environments
- Integration of multiple data sources and databases into one system
- Understanding fundamental design principles behind a scalable application
- Understanding differences between multiple delivery platforms, such as mobile vs. desktop, and optimizing output to match the specific platform
- Creating database schemas that represent and support business processes.
- Strong interpersonal and communication skills
- Strong analytical abilities
- Project and time management skills
- Quick learner with a positive attitude
Qualifications:
- Master’s / Bachelor’s degree in Computer Science, Software engineering or related area from a good institute is preferred
Reports to: Lead- Software Engineering


- Experienced in C# MVC
- Should have good knowledge in JavaScript, SQL, RDBMS Concepts and Microsoft .NET
- Framework, practical implementation of Object Oriented Concepts, N-Tier Architecture
- development and understanding of JSON, XML, SOAP.
- Good hands-on coding skills in Java Script, Ajax, C#, ASP.Net, jQuery
Knowledge of working Android iOS mobile development would be added advantage - Good communication and analytical skills are must.
- Candidates with experience will be preferred.
Primary Roles and Responsibilities:
- Participate in requirements analysis.
- Collaborate with internal teams to develop software design and architecture.
- Candidate should be able to write clean, scalable code using C#.
- Revise, update, refactor and debug code.
- Test and deploy applications.
- Resourcefulness and troubleshooting.
- Good analytical and problem solving skills.




Job Description
We are looking for a Back-End Web Developer responsible for managing the interchange of data between the server and the users. Your primary focus will be development of all server-side logic, definition and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ements built by your coworkers into the application. A basic understanding of front-end technologies is therefore necessary as well.
Responsibilities
- Integration of user-facing elements developed by a front-end developers with server side logic
- Building reusable code and libraries for future use
- Optimization of the application for maximum speed and scalability
- Implementation of security and data protection
- Design and implementation of data storage solutions
Skills And Qualifications
- Basic understanding of front-end technologies and platforms, such as JavaScript, HTML5, Nodejs and CSS3
- Good understanding of server-side CSS pre-processors, such as LESS and SASS
- User authentication and authorization between multiple systems, servers, and environments
- Good Understanding of Mysql database.
- Management of hosting environment, including database administration and scaling an application to support load changes
- Data migration, transformation, and scripting
- Setup and administration of backups
- Outputting data in different formats


Roles & Responsibilities:
-
Strong knowledge of Asp.Net MVC, C#, MVC, JavaScript and JQuery.
-
Prepare and maintain code for various .Net applications and resolve any defects in systems.
-
Prepare test-based applications for various Dot Net applications.
-
Enhance existing systems by analyzing business objectives, preparing an action plan and identifying areas for modification and improvement.
-
Manage defect tracking systems and resolve all issues and prepare an update for systems.
-
Investigate and develop skills in new technologies.
Skills Required:
-
Proven experience as a .NET Developer or https://resources.workable.com/application-developer-job-description" target="_blank">Application Developer.
-
Familiarity with the http://asp.net/" target="_blank">ASP.NET framework, SQL Server and design/architectural patterns (e.g. Model-View-Controller (MVC)).
-
Knowledge of at least one of the .NET languages (e.g. C#, Visual Basic .NET) and HTML5/CSS3.
-
Familiarity with JavaScript and JQuery.
-
Understanding of Agile methodologies.
-
Excellent troubleshooting and communication skills.




